Transaction 3c204479589f1f754b0de7e1faebc8ba76bfc10198ab800e1842aaf4c813e33f

2 Input
2 Outputs
  • 3c204479589f1f754b0de7e1faebc8ba76bfc10198ab800e1842aaf4c813e33f:0
  • value  538951
    address  15VGQTXezQejYsTbcDp7WudC1JmKzqXSSD
  • 3c204479589f1f754b0de7e1faebc8ba76bfc10198ab800e1842aaf4c813e33f:1
  • value  1717780
    address  35z9fqmnx8D7yKXfYiBRGhXq34TriEBWxV